Chronological records

1899

Thomas Steels1899

Doncaster · Politics / Independent Labour Party

A Doncaster member of the Amalgamated Society of Railway Servants proposes that the Trade Union Congress call a special conference to bring together all the left-wing organisations into a single body

1900

James Keir Hardie1900

London · Politics / Independent Labour Party

129 Trades Unions delegates pass Hardie's motion to establish "a distinct Labour group in Parliament"

James Keir Hardie1900

London · Politics / Independent Labour Party

Helps create an association called the Labour Representation Committee (LRC) to coordinate attempts to support MPs sponsored by trade unions and represent the working-class population
